`

C++__容器

阅读更多
http://apps.hi.baidu.com/share/detail/31588384

容器空间不足时,如何增量
http://blog.csdn.net/ShowLong/archive/2009/07/09/4333842.aspx

set、map的优势
http://space.itpub.net/16856446/viewspace-626580


数据结构
http://ks.cn.yahoo.com/question/1508030403560.html




//  map



分享到:
评论

相关推荐

    C++_容器详解

    C++ 容器详解 C++ 容器是 C++ 标准库中的一组类模板,提供了多种数据结构的实现,包括链表、向量、队列、栈、树等。今天,我们来详细讲解 C++ 容器中的一种重要数据结构:链表(Lists)。 链表(Lists) 链表是一...

    C++_STL之set容器使用方法

    ### C++ STL之set容器使用方法 #### 一、引言 在C++标准模板库(STL)中,`set`容器是一种非常重要的关联容器,主要用于存储唯一元素,并且这些元素会根据其键值自动排序。`set`内部通常采用红黑树(一种自平衡的二叉...

    C++_MFC_容器、标准库、模板.

    在这个主题中,我们将深入探讨C++中的容器、标准库以及模板。 首先,让我们来看看C++的容器。容器是STL(Standard Template Library,标准模板库)的一部分,它们提供了数据结构和算法,如数组、列表、向量、映射、...

    1c++_C++_

    8. **STL(Standard Template Library)**:STL是C++库的一部分,包含容器(如vector、list、set等)、迭代器、算法和函数对象,是高效编程的重要工具。 9. **内存管理**:C++允许直接管理内存,包括使用new和...

    ActiveX文档容器.rar_ActiveX Visual C++_C#容器_activeX c#_activex

    综合这些文件,我们可以推测这是一个使用Visual C++开发的MFC ActiveX控件项目,该控件能够作为文档容器,承载和管理各种类型的文档,并且可能支持脚本交互。在C#项目中,这个控件可以通过AxHost或WebBrowser控件被...

    big_1_C++_文件压缩c++_Big!_

    开发者可能还会用到`vector`和`string`等标准模板库(STL)容器,来存储和操作数据。 为了实现压缩,首先需要读取原始文件内容,然后分析数据,找出重复或频繁出现的模式。这可能涉及到统计字符频率、构建频率表,...

    C++_Collection_web

    4. **Effective STL 笔记若干-有关STL使用需要注意的方面** - 有效STL的笔记可能涵盖了一些使用STL容器、迭代器、算法的最佳实践,以及常见的陷阱和错误。 5. **在C++实现C#中的属性(Property)功能的尝试 MACRO篇...

    J2EE_5.0.rar_chm_j2ee 5 c++_j2ee5.0_j2ee5.0 api c++_j2ee5.0 api

    这个CHM文件《J2EE_5.0.rar_chm_j2ee 5 c++_j2ee5.0_j2ee5.0 api c++_j2ee5.0 api》显然是关于J2EE 5.0的详细文档,其中可能涵盖了与C++集成以及J2EE 5.0 API在C++环境中的应用。 J2EE 5.0的主要改进和特性包括: ...

    C++_标准模板库(STL)_C++_C++STL_C++标准库_

    C++标准模板库(STL)是C++编程语言中不可或缺的一部分,它是现代C++编程的基础,极大地提高了代码的效率和可复用性。STL包括了五个主要组件:容器、迭代器、算法、函数对象(也称为适配器)以及分配器。下面将详细...

    第8版C++_C++_

    - 标准库的使用:学习如容器(vector, list, map等)、算法和迭代器等。 - 进阶主题:异常处理、多线程编程、智能指针、STL算法等。 通过21天的学习计划,你可以逐步掌握C++的基础和进阶内容,结合实际编程练习,...

    C++2_C++_Book2_

    7. **改进的`std::ranges`**:C++20加强了`std::ranges`库,提供了更强大的函数对象和算法,如`views`和`actions`,使处理容器和序列变得更加简洁和高效。 8. **库增强**:C++20还包括对库的许多扩展,如`std::bit_...

    c++文档_C++_

    C++标准库是C++编程的重要组成部分,提供了大量的容器(如vector、list、set)、算法(如排序、查找)、输入/输出流(iostream)、智能指针(shared_ptr、unique_ptr)等工具,极大地提高了开发效率。 总的来说,这...

    Curso C++_CursoC++_C++Curso_C++_

    5. **STL(标准模板库)**:STL是C++的一个重要组成部分,包括容器(如vector、list、set等)、算法(如排序、查找等)和迭代器,是高效编程的必备工具。 6. **异常处理**:C++的异常处理机制使得程序在遇到错误时...

    cPP.rar_c++ 容器使用_容器

    - **RAII(Resource Acquisition Is Initialization)**:C++容器遵循RAII原则,资源(如内存)在对象创建时分配,并在对象销毁时自动释放,确保了资源管理的正确性。 理解并熟练运用这些C++容器及其规则,能够显著...

    STL.rar_C++ STL_C++ STL_STL_STL c++_STL教程

    C++中的STL,全称为Standard Template Library(标准模板库),是C++编程语言中一个极其重要的组成部分。它提供了一组高效、灵活且可重用的容器、算法和迭代器等编程工具,大大简化了复杂的数据结构操作和算法实现。...

    Accelerated.C++_C++_likegnc_Accelerated_

    在《Accelerated C++》中,读者会学习如何使用标准模板库(STL),这是C++的标准库,包含了各种容器(如vector、list、map)、算法和迭代器,极大地提高了代码的可读性和效率。此外,书籍也会涉及输入/输出流(I/O ...

    aide-memoire_de_c++_aide_C++_memoire_

    4. **STL(Standard Template Library)**:C++标准库中的STL提供了容器(如vector、list、set、map)、迭代器、算法和函数对象,极大地提高了C++程序员的生产力。 5. **异常处理**:C++的异常处理机制允许程序在...

    C_C++_Java_Python——API

    例如,STL(标准模板库)是C++的一个重要API,它提供了容器(如vector和list)、算法和迭代器等。理解和使用C++ API需要掌握面向对象编程,模板元编程以及异常处理等概念。 Java API: Java的API非常丰富,它由Java...

    《Visual_C++_实用教程(第3版)》课件

    - 变量和对象:存储数据的容器,对象是类的实例。 - 输入/输出:iostream库提供了cin和cout用于从标准输入设备获取数据和向标准输出设备显示数据。 - 注释:用于解释代码功能,提高代码可读性。 1.1.3 C++程序的...

    [AddisonWesley]Design_Components_With_C++_STL.zip

    STL是C++编程中的一个强大工具,它包括容器、迭代器、算法和函数对象等组成部分,极大地提升了C++程序员的生产力。 在书中,作者深入浅出地介绍了STL的基本概念和使用方法,涵盖了如vector、list、set、map等基本...

Global site tag (gtag.js) - Google Analytics